Output 91574838ad17dd8c35fa5c7d9267e1d1e90e5ceab313aa52c24e35ef68e5da89:1
- value
- 752803806
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 a9db6e3dc585814ebae74d3c91947bc8bff9de8e OP_EQUALVERIFY OP_CHECKSIG
- address
- DLdDbz6cKXQrsFVbA9e4HnbHbMYWgUovbg
- transaction
- 91574838ad17dd8c35fa5c7d9267e1d1e90e5ceab313aa52c24e35ef68e5da89